Hyderabad: Relatives of a 54-year-old resident from Hyderabad, Y Prabhakar Reddy, who was declared as brain dead by the attending team of neuro-physicians, have donated the organs of the deceased to needy patients under the State-run Jeevandan organ donation initiative.

A resident of RTC Cross Roads, Jawahar Nagar, Prabhakar Reddy was found unconscious on his bed at 6.30 am on November 8. Relatives including his wife Y Usha Rani, 23-year-old daughter Sai Manisha and 19-year-old son Y Kailash, rushed him to Sunshine Hospitals, Secunderabad for emergency treatment.

The doctors at Sunshine Hospitals extended intensive care for 24-hours but due to poor prognosis, the health condition of Reddy did not improve. On November 9 at 6.30 pm, the hospital neuro-physicians declared him as brain dead due to severe IC (intracranial) bleed that occurs among brain haemorrhage patients.

A series of grief counselling sessions were conducted by organ donation volunteers from Jeevandan and Sunshine Hospitals following which the family members agreed to donate the organs of the deceased under Jeevandan organ donation initiative.

The hospital transplant surgeons retrieved liver, lungs and two corneas and sent them to various centres for transplantation based on the organ donation guidelines of Jeevandan.
